Paste with Frames features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Paste with Frames offers an intuitive and clean interface that allows users to create and organize their content easily. Its simplicity minimizes the learning curve for new users.
  • Real-Time Collaboration
    The platform supports real-time collaboration, enabling teams to work together seamlessly without delays, ensuring productivity and efficient workflow.
  • Rich Media Support
    Users can embed various types of media, such as images, videos, and links, directly into their documents, enhancing the visual appeal and depth of the content.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    Paste with Frames is accessible on multiple devices and operating systems, providing flexibility for users to work from anywhere with internet access.
  • Organizational Tools
    The app offers strong organizational features such as collections and tags, allowing users to categorize and retrieve their content efficiently.

Possible disadvantages of Paste with Frames

  • Limited Free Version
    The free version of Paste with Frames might have restrictions on features or storage, which could limit its usability for users not willing to upgrade to a paid plan.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While the basic interface is simple, mastering more advanced features may require additional time and effort, which could be a drawback for some users.
  • Dependency on Internet Connection
    The platform relies heavily on an internet connection, potentially hindering usability in areas with poor connectivity or for users who frequently work offline.
  • Limited Customization Options
    While Paste with Frames provides various templates, the scope for customizing these templates may be limited, potentially constraining users who require extensive design flexibility.

php eventloop features and specs

  • Simple and lightweight
    The library provides a minimalistic implementation of an event loop in PHP, making it easy to understand and integrate into small projects without heavy dependencies.
  • Educational value
    As a straightforward PHP event loop implementation, it serves as a great learning resource for developers wanting to understand how event loops and asynchronous programming concepts work under the hood in PHP.
  • Non-blocking I/O support
    The library enables non-blocking I/O operations in PHP, allowing developers to handle multiple tasks concurrently without relying on multi-threading, which PHP does not natively support well.
  • Timer and periodic task support
    It provides built-in support for timers and periodic tasks, enabling developers to schedule recurring operations or delayed execution within the event loop.
  • Pure PHP implementation
    The library is written in pure PHP without requiring external C extensions, making it portable and easy to install across different PHP environments without special compilation steps.

Possible disadvantages of php eventloop

  • Limited community and support
    The project has a very small community with minimal stars, forks, and contributors on GitHub, which means limited peer support, fewer bug reports, and potentially slower issue resolution.
  • Not production-ready
    Given its small scale and limited adoption, the library may not be battle-tested enough for production environments where reliability, performance, and stability are critical.
  • Limited features compared to alternatives
    More established PHP async libraries like ReactPHP, AmpPHP, and others offer far more comprehensive ecosystems with HTTP servers, database clients, and stream handling that this library lacks.
  • Performance limitations
    Being a pure PHP implementation without leveraging extensions like ev, libuv, or swoole, the event loop may suffer from performance bottlenecks compared to extension-backed alternatives when handling high concurrency.
  • Poor documentation
    The repository has minimal documentation and examples, making it difficult for new users to understand the full API, edge cases, and best practices for using the library effectively.
